* * * * S.J. VAZIFDAR, A.C.J. (ORAL) The petitioner apprehends that respondent No. 1 may not consider his bid as the fee for the tender form of ` 575/- was not received by respondent No. 1.
2.
There is no rejection of the petitioner's bid. The petitioner only seeks an order directing respondent No. 1 to consider his representation to have his bid entertained and not rejected for the amount having not been remitted to respondent No. 1 due to no fault of his. Respondent No. 2 - the bank has by a certificate dated 26.11.2015 (Annexure P-4) admitted that the fault was on the part of respondent No. 2 and not the petitioner. 3.
The petition is, therefore, disposed of by directing respondent No. 1 to consider the petitioner's above representation especially in the light of the certificate issued by respondent No. 2 dated 26.11.2015 (Annexure P-4).
4.
In the event of respondent No. 1 rejecting the petitioner's bid for want of the fee for the tender form of ` 575/-, the petitioner is at liberty to file a fresh writ petition.
